Axial Lead & Cartridge Fuses

2AG > Time Lag > 209 Series

Product Characteristics

Dimensions

Materials

Body : Glass

Cap : Nickel–plated brass

Leads: Tin–plated Copper

Terminal Strength

MIL-STD-202G, Method 211A,

Test Condition A

Solderability

Reference IEC 60127 Second Edition

2003-01 Annex A

Product Marking

Cap1 : Brand logo, current and voltage

ratings

Cap2 : Series and agency approval marks

Operating
Temperature:

–55ºC to 125ºC.

Thermal
Shock:

MIL-STD-202G, Method 107G, Test Condition B

(5 Cycles -65ºC to +125ºC).

Vibration

MIL-STD-202G, Method 201A

Humidity

MIL-STD-202G, Method 103B, Test Condition

A: High RH (95%) and elevated temp (40ºC)

for 240 hours

Salt Spray

MIL-STD-202G, Method 101D, Test Condition B
